To mask a partially blurred subject where it's in deep focus and gradually becomes out of focus, you have to CONSIDER that within the mask as well.
with The "object selection tool". or with the laso and applying Select and mask. Now after the subject is masked and even the the blurred edges could be sharp and that's ok, you grab the blur tool and put in as much as you need for the edges on the MASK. Go to the smudge tool and just push the edges inside in the Mask.
A second way is by selecting the subject like in the beginning and applying Select-modify-Contract to the selection put like 3px.
mask just the blured edges areas and apply some Surface blur to the mask as needed, can be even 10 times (Ctrl+alt+F)
after that you can select the subject again and mask with white the other part you've left out. this time it'd be the part in focus
